1985 TRAVELCRAFT TRAVELCRAFT

1985 TRAVELCRAFT TRAVELCRAFT Recall Title: FUEL SYSTEM, GASOLINE:STORAGE:TANK ASSEMBLY:FILLER PIPE AND CAP

1985 TRAVELCRAFT TRAVELCRAFT Recall Date: 1988-06-24

1985 TRAVELCRAFT TRAVELCRAFT NHTSA Recall Campaign Number: 88V100000

1985 TRAVELCRAFT TRAVELCRAFT Recall Manufacturer: TRAVELCRAFT INC.

1985 TRAVELCRAFT TRAVELCRAFT Recall Component(s): FUEL SYSTEM, GASOLINE:STORAGE:TANK ASSEMBLY:FILLER PIPE AND CAP

1985 TRAVELCRAFT TRAVELCRAFT Recall - Potential Number of Units Affected: 415

1985 TRAVELCRAFT TRAVELCRAFT Recall Overview: TRUCKS ARE SUBJECT TO PRESSURIZATION OF THE FUEL TANK UNDER CERTAIN CONDITIONS.

Just What Is a Car Recall? Car Safety Recall Definition - A safety recall is an automotive manufacturer's way of notifying vehicle customers that their product has a flaw. The automobile problem is serious enough that if you do not correct the flaw your and/or your passengers' safety could be at risk. Generally recalls are initiated by the US Government, but sometimes individual car manufacturers will pre-emptively initiate a recall.

1985 TRAVELCRAFT TRAVELCRAFT Recall Remedy: REPLACE CAP FOR THE FUEL FILLER LINE.

1985 TRAVELCRAFT TRAVELCRAFT Recall Notes: SYSTEM: FUEL TANK.VEHICLE DESCRIPTION: CLASS A MOTORHOMES OVER 10,000 GVWR AND OVER 27 FEET LONG.
